Pine Tree Clearing in Marietta, GA
Pine Tree Clearing services involve the removal and thinning of pine trees to improve the health, safety, and appearance of a property. This service is commonly requested for projects such as creating open spaces for new construction, reducing the risk of falling branches, or managing overgrown areas to enhance landscape aesthetics. Homeowners often seek pine tree clearing to prevent damage to structures, improve sunlight exposure, or prepare a site for future landscaping or development.
Before requesting pine tree clearing, property owners should consider the size and number of trees to be removed, as well as the location within the property. It’s helpful to identify any trees that may be near utility lines, structures, or other valuable landscape features. Understanding the scope of the project and any potential restrictions or permits required can ensure a smooth and effective process. Clear communication about goals and expectations can help achieve the desired results for a safe and attractive property.

Common Pine Tree Clearing Jobs
Tree removal - safely removing dead or hazardous trees to improve property safety.
Land clearing - clearing overgrown areas to create open space for landscaping or construction.
Stump grinding - grinding down tree stumps to restore lawn appearance and prevent pest issues.
Brush removal - clearing thick brush and undergrowth to enhance yard usability.
Lot preparation - preparing land for new construction or landscaping projects.
Emergency clearing - quick removal of fallen trees or debris after storms or severe weather.
Pine Tree Clearing Questions
What types of trees can be cleared? Pine tree clearing services typically handle a variety of pine species and other coniferous trees, depending on the property’s needs.
When is the best time for pine tree clearing? The best time usually depends on the project scope, but generally, late winter or early spring are ideal for minimizing impact on the landscape.
Is pine tree clearing safe for nearby structures? Yes, proper techniques are used to ensure trees are removed safely without damaging surrounding structures or landscaping.
What should property owners consider before pine tree clearing? It's important to assess the size and location of the trees to determine the best approach for safe and efficient removal.
